In 1998 Bill Gates co-workers had finally convinced him that Microsoft would enter the war of gaming consoles in which Sony and Nintendo were leading in (“A Brief History of the Xbox”). The Microsoft company along with Bill Gates had decided that they were going to create a console that worked kind of like a computer. The Microsoft team decided to show the world there Xbox in 2000 (“A Brief History of the Xbox”). It took a total of 2 years to show their new console to the world. One of the latest Xbox is much different than it was the very first Xbox. The Xbox One is one of the latest Xbox released. The Xbox one was released on November 22, 2013 (Johnson). The Xbox comes with many new features. “Plus, it improves on its predecessor with a faster processor, more memory, better graphics, very quick switching between applications and a newfound ability to multitask” (“Johnson”).
